Manchester City’s manager, Pep Guardiola, has offered his insights into the team’s 1-0 defeat against Aston Villa in the Premier League on Wednesday night.
The decisive goal came from Leon Bailey’s deflected strike in the second half.
City’s recent struggles are evident as they have been unable to secure victories in their last four league matches.
Reflecting on the loss at Villa Park, Guardiola acknowledged Aston Villa’s superiority, stating, “Aston Villa outperformed us. We encountered challenges in our processes, especially when they adopted a medium defensive block. Finding opportunities behind their defense became particularly difficult.”
He emphasized the formidable physicality of the opposition, making it tough for City to assert control over various aspects of the game.
The defeat has pushed Guardiola’s side down to fourth place in the league standings, trailing leaders Arsenal by six points, while Aston Villa has climbed to the third position, leapfrogging City in the process.
